Breaker Replacement in Provo, UT
Breaker replacement services involve removing outdated or faulty circuit breakers and installing new units to ensure electrical systems operate safely and efficiently. This service covers a variety of projects, including upgrading old panels, replacing damaged breakers, or installing new circuit breakers to support additional electrical loads. Homeowners typically request breaker replacement when experiencing frequent tripping, electrical outages, or when upgrading their electrical panel to meet increased power needs.
Before requesting breaker replacement, property owners often want to understand the condition of their existing electrical panel and whether the current breakers are compatible with new equipment or appliances. It’s also helpful to know if the electrical system requires an upgrade to handle higher capacity or to improve safety. Proper assessment can identify underlying issues that might affect the performance and safety of the electrical system, ensuring that the replacement process addresses both immediate concerns and long-term reliability.

Signs You Need A Breaker Replacement
Frequent breaker trips or flickering lights can indicate a faulty breaker that needs replacement.
Benefits Of Upgrading Your Breakers
Replacing outdated breakers enhances electrical safety and supports the demands of modern appliances.
Common Causes Of Breaker Failure
Overloading circuits, power surges, and age can lead to breaker malfunctions requiring professional replacement.

Common Breaker Replacement Jobs
Breaker Replacement - Upgrading outdated or damaged circuit breakers to ensure reliable electrical performance.
Main Breaker Replacement - Replacing main service panel breakers to support increased electrical needs.
Arc Fault Breaker Replacement - Installing or replacing AFCI breakers to prevent electrical fires.
GFCI Breaker Replacement - Updating ground-fault circuit interrupters in kitchens and bathrooms for safety.
Panel Upgrade Services - Replacing or expanding breaker panels to accommodate additional circuits.
Troubleshooting and Replacement - Identifying breaker issues and replacing faulty units to restore electrical system safety.
Breaker Replacement Questions
What are signs that a breaker needs replacement? Frequent tripping, a breaker that feels hot, or visible damage indicate it may need to be replaced.
Is breaker replacement safe for my home? Yes, breaker replacement is a standard electrical service performed by professionals to ensure safety and reliability.
How do I know if my breaker is the right size? An electrician can assess your electrical load and recommend the correct breaker size for your system.
What types of breakers are available for replacement? There are various types, including standard, GFCI, and AFCI breakers, suitable for different circuits and needs.
